Основна роль хешу в криптовалютах

Хешування є критично важливим процесом у світі криптовалют, який перетворює дані будь-якого розміру на рядок символів фіксованої довжини. Цей механізм, реалізований через математичні алгоритми, відомі як функції хеш, є необхідним для забезпечення безпеки та цілісності мереж блокчейн.

Криптографічні хеш-функції, зокрема, є серцем систем криптовалют. Ці функції мають характеристику детермінованості, що означає, що для конкретного входу вони завжди видаватимуть один і той же результат або "хеш". Крім того, вони розроблені так, щоб бути односторонніми, що робить практично неможливим повернення процесу без значної кількості часу та обчислювальних ресурсів.

Робота хеш-функцій

Щоб ілюструвати, як працює функція хешу, візьмемо за приклад алгоритм SHA-256, широко використовуваний в екосистемі криптовалют. Якщо ми введемо слово "Gate" в цей алгоритм, ми отримаємо унікальний хеш довжиною 256 біт. Якщо ми змінимо навіть один символ, наприклад, "Gate", результат буде зовсім іншим, хоча завжди матиме таку ж довжину 256 біт.

Важливо зазначити, що існують різні типи алгоритмів хешування, такі як SHA-1 і SHA-256, які виробляють результати різної довжини. Однак для конкретного алгоритму довжина хешу завжди буде сталою, незалежно від розміру вхідних даних.

Важливість у технології блокчейн

Хеш-функції відіграють ключову роль у різних аспектах технології блокчейн. У процесі майнінгу криптовалют, наприклад, майнери повинні виконувати численні операції хешу, щоб знайти правильне рішення для наступного блоку. Цей процес не тільки забезпечує мережу, але й регулює випуск нових монет.

Крім того, хешування використовується для зв'язування блоків транзакцій, створюючи таким чином ланцюг блоків. Кожен блок містить хеш попереднього блоку, формуючи криптографічне з'єднання, яке практично унеможливлює зміну інформації без виявлення.

Властивості криптографічних хеш-функцій

Щоб хеш-функція вважалася криптографічно безпечною, вона повинна відповідати трьом основним властивостям:

  1. Стійкість до колізій: надзвичайно малоймовірно знайти два різних входи, які генерують однаковий хеш.

  2. Стійкість до преіміджу: Неприпустимо знайти оригінальний вхід на основі даного хешу.

  3. Стійкість до другої преображення: Заданий хеш та його оригінальний вхід, практично неможливо знайти інший вхід, який би виробляв той самий хеш.

Ці властивості є вирішальними для підтримки безпеки та цілісності систем, заснованих на blockchain.

Застосування у видобутку криптовалют

У контексті видобутку криптовалют, функції хеш використовуються різними способами. Майнерам потрібно знайти хеш, який відповідає певним критеріям, таким як початок з конкретної кількості нулів. Складність цього процесу автоматично регулюється, щоб підтримувати середній час між створенням блоків.

"Хешрейт" мережі, який представляє загальну обчислювальну потужність, присвячену видобутку, є важливим показником безпеки мережі. Вищий хешрейт робить мережу більш стійкою до атак і маніпуляцій.

Важливо зазначити, що Gate, як і інші платформи обміну криптовалют, непрямо виграє від цих процесів хешування, які забезпечують мережі блокчейн, в яких функціонують криптовалюти, що торгуються на його платформі.

У підсумку, криптографічні хеш-функції є фундаментальним компонентом архітектури криптовалют та технологій блокчейн. Їхня здатність забезпечувати цілісність даних, безпеку та ефективність у обробці інформації робить їх незамінним інструментом у світі децентралізованих цифрових фінансів.

Переглянути оригінал
Ця сторінка може містити контент третіх осіб, який надається виключно в інформаційних цілях (не в якості запевнень/гарантій) і не повинен розглядатися як схвалення його поглядів компанією Gate, а також як фінансова або професійна консультація. Див. Застереження для отримання детальної інформації.
  • Нагородити
  • Прокоментувати
  • Репост
  • Поділіться
Прокоментувати
0/400
Немає коментарів
  • Закріпити